USA: Free $30 Oye! Times readers Get FREE $30 to spend on Amazon, Walmart…Groundbreaking Canadian Dance Co. Les Ballet Jazz de Montreal Returns to L.A.

Wallis Annenberg Center for the Performing Arts (Beverly Hills, CA)

Les Ballet Jazz de Montreal

Following sold-out performances at the Wallis this past season, Les Ballets Jazz de Montréal returns to L.A. with an all-new program featuring a truly global trio of choreographers: Spain’s Cayetano Soto (Zero in On), Greece’s Andonis Fionadakis (Kosmos) and Brazil’s Rodrigo Pederneiras, who’ll premiere his latest work, Rouge. An internationally renowned repertory company led by artistic director Louis Robitaille, Les Ballet Jazz de Montreal has continued to break new and exciting ground since its formation in 1972. Known for its stunning theatricality and impressive physicality, BJM explores the creative side of contemporary trends while remaining firmly committed to the techniques and aesthetics of classical dance.
